Driven Tuning Fork
Purpose
Demonstrates mechanical resonance by driving a 256 Hz tuning fork with a speaker at various frequencies. Ping pong balls resting against the tines bounce vigorously at the resonant frequency and stop within a few tenths of a Hz off-resonance, making the sharpness of the resonance peak visually dramatic.
Figure 1:
Tuning fork at resonance (256 Hz). The ping pong balls bounce vigorously off the vibrating tines, appearing blurred in the photo. The small speaker directs sound into the open end of the wooden resonator box.
Figure 2:
Two tuning forks with the full apparatus. The ping pong balls hang at rest against the tines of the left fork when the driving frequency is off-resonance.
